What I noted is that the BASIC and rest of the kernal ROM actually
jump directly into some entry points, and not via jump table.
So you have to work around those entry points.

> I have started a new project, which is kind of an extension to my ColourPET
> and Keyboard Replacement projects. This is a project to create PET/CBM
> Editor ROMs. This will eventually allow anyone to build an Editor ROM
> containing any combination of 40/80 column screen, N/B/DIN/C64 keyboard,
> 50/60 Hz, or custom video setting (such as NTSC or PAL), plus addition
> features such as ColourPET, C128 ESC sequences, Soft-40 column, autoboot,
> or keyboard reboot.
